The fluid tends to flow into the filter through the filter inlet. The filter lamination tends to get pressed tightly due to the action of the spring force. The impurity particles get trapped in the lamination cross. The clean liquid flows out through the filter’s main channel.
The filter disc follows the specific principle of backwashing. When a specific pressure difference is reached, the controller controls the valve to open. After the set time, the valve flap may also enter the backwash state.
When disc acquires the backwashing stage, the one-way diaphragm present at the bottom of the filter closes the main channel. The jetting is in the tangential direction of the lamination. As a result, the spray water gets sprayed over the surface of the lamination. The impurities present on the lamination get ejected.
After the backwash is completed, the water flow shut-off valve is closed and the system tends to re-enter the filtration state. The exciting part is that the backwashing process of the sintered filter disc is automatic.
The working and the backwashing state get switched automatically. The benefit of this practice is that you can look forward to continuous water discharge. The best part is that high speed backwashing can get done at a very high speed.

There are various processes that you can adopt for cleaning stainless steel filter disc. When you want to clean the disc, then the simplest process is to soak and flush the disc. For this, you will need to make use of a detergent solution.
You will need to soak your disc in the detergent solution so that you can loosen the particles.
You can also clean the filter discs through the process of furnace cleaning. The process involves burning biological compounds for cleaning the filter disc. The method works well when you need to remove polymer materials.
You can also clean the filter disc through the process of circulation flow. Now, a cleaning system is a dire need for circulation flow. You will need a cleaning solution that can pump the cleaning solution through the filter mesh.
Ultrasonic baths are also useful when you need to clean your filter disc. The ultrasonic waves tend to trigger off the particles and they get removed from the filter mesh.
There are times when particles badly block the filter mesh. In this case, you will need to use hydro blasting method for cleaning your filter disc. High pressure water jet gets used in this situation. It removes the trapped particles from the filter mesh without a problem.
